Real-time visualization reveals Mycobacterium tuberculosis ESAT-6 disrupts phagosome via fibril-mediated vesiculation

Debraj Koiri,
Mintu Nandi,
P M Abik Hameem
et al.

Abstract: Mycobacterium tuberculosis (Mtb) evades host defense by hijacking and rupturing the phagosome, enabling it to escape to the host cytosol for its survival. ESAT-6, a secreted virulence protein of Mtb, is known to be critical for phagosome rupture. However, the mechanism of ESAT-6-mediated disruption of the phagosomal membrane remains unknown.
